Typically meet with the patient before surgery to discuss their options, and the recommended surgical procedure and answer questions the patient may have. If the patient consents to the surgery, the general surgeon then schedules the surgery and performs the operation alongside other medical professionals, such as other doctors and nurses. The final responsibilities of general surgeons occur after the procedure when they discuss the success of the operation with the patient and their loved ones. They also provide post-operation care, ensuring that there are no complications from the surgery.
